What will the apprentice be doing?
You will be:
- Managing rotas ensuring these are used to the best effect for the physical, social and emotional care of residents and effective running of the establishment.
- Ensuring that team members understand and endorse the Trust values.
- Responsible for clear lines of communication ensuring employees is fully conversant with their duties.
- Supporting and participating in any training requirements.
- Ensuring all medications, including controlled drugs are administered, recorded, maintained, and replenished at all times in accordance with the Trust policies and procedures.
- Ensuring care is delivered in accordance with the care plan.
Monitoring and re-evaluating care needs in partnership with the resident. - Promoting resident wellbeing by monitoring and re-evaluation of care needs in partnership with the resident.
What training will the apprentice take and what qualification will the apprentice get at the end?
Over the course of 18 months (dependent upon the level of course an apprentice is being enrolled onto), you will study modules such as personal development in care settings, the responsibilities of a care worker, handling information in care settings, implementing person-centred care plans, safeguarding & protection in care settings, duty of care in care settings, communication in care settings, equality & inclusion in care settings and health & safety and wellbeing in care settings (these units may differ).
Upon successful completion of the apprenticeship programme, you will achieve a Level 3 qualification and a TQUK Diploma in Care.
